Questerre Energy said that pipeline for its 14-30 well in Kakwa-Resthaven area has been completed to tie-in to a third party processing plant.

Announced earlier, the well was put on production for a short time in the beginning of January with very high condensate production, in excess of 200 Bbls/MMcf.

The operator of the wells will now equip both the 14-30 Well and the 03-19 Well with central facilities to allow condensate separation at the wellhead.

The process will facilitate the flow of natural gas and natural gas liquids to the third party processing plant that cannot handle very high condensate volumes.

It will also improve uptime and reduce operating costs with condensate being trucked directly to the pipeline.

Questerre also said that drilling of the horizontal section at 03-19 well, in the target interval of the Upper Montney formation is currently continuing at a measured depth of about 4100m.

The company holds 25% interest in the 14-30 and 03-19 wells.
